Description

A kind of vertical surface carving machine
Technical field
The utility model is related to finishing impression manufacture fields, particularly relate to a kind of vertical surface carving machine.
Background technology
For carving machine when processing part, there is also machining accuracies not enough, size disunity, since cutter has ground at present Fang Buneng reaches, so will appear processing dead angle, the part no more than 4 can only be generally processed, so there is also processing efficiencies Low problem, the polished silicon wafer that polishing machining uses will produce the dust of copper, aluminium when processing.In this way during processing It can affect to the health of worker, and air is polluted.
Utility model content
The utility model aim is to provide a kind of high-precision, the vertical surface carving machine of highly-efficient processing and processing without dead angle.
The utility model is achieved through the following technical solutions:A kind of vertical surface carving machine, including engine base, on the engine base The lower section of workbench equipped with mounting tool, workbench is equipped with saddle;
Column is provided on engine base, the babinet slide being provided on column above workbench is arranged on babinet slide Promising process tool provides the electro spindle of kinetic energy;
Further include servo motor, Serve Motor Control workbench moves in the X direction, directly controls saddle and drives workbench It moves in the Y direction, also controls babinet slide and electro spindle moves in z-direction.
Further, it is preferably to realize the utility model, is specifically arranged to following structures:The process tool is ball Knife.
Further, it is preferably to realize the utility model, is specifically arranged to following structures:The process tool and ball Lead screw connects, and ball screw is driven by servo motor.
Further, it is preferably to realize the utility model, is specifically arranged to following structures:The lower section of the saddle is arranged There is chip removal screw rod.
Further, it is preferably to realize the utility model, is specifically arranged to following structures:The workbench is equipped with peace Fill the frock clamp of tooling.
Further, it is preferably to realize the utility model, is specifically arranged to following structures:The frock clamp includes gas Cylinder and the upper plate being connect with cylinder are connected with fixture pattern on upper plate;Workpiece compression bar is also associated on cylinder and for controlling gas The hand valve that the fixture of cylinder unclamps and steps up.
Further, it is preferably to realize the utility model, is specifically arranged to following structures:The quantity of the cylinder is at least There are two.
Further, it is preferably to realize the utility model, is specifically arranged to following structures:The quantity of the frock clamp It is eight.
The utility model compared with prior art, has the following advantages and advantageous effect:
One, the utility model is related to fine carving machine using high-speed electric main shaft ensure finish, the direction of feed of main shaft It is carried out on X, Y of workpiece, Z-direction, reduces the dead angle of process appearance;
Two, all ball screw feed is driven to ensure that machining accuracy, the ball knife processing of use process using servo motor The overall dimensions come are same, highly polished, and the external form of product can process to obtain, without dead angle, high in machining efficiency primary Property can process 8 products;
Three, the utility model processes copper scale, aluminium skimmings can recycle i.e. clean and tidy and environmentally friendly automatically.Polish machining Carrying out product design size can not unify, and the dead angle of product can not process.Polishing machining use polished silicon wafer processing when Wait the dust that will produce copper, aluminium.It can affect to the health of worker during processing in this way, and to sky Gas pollutes;
Four, the utility model frock clamp has certain advantage, and Workpiece length is long, shape is more complicated all may be used To be stepped up using frock clamp, front and the reverse side of workpiece can be disposably shelled, the time of processing is saved, improves work Make efficiency.

Specific implementation mode
The utility model is described in further detail with reference to embodiment, but the embodiment of the utility model is not It is limited to this.
Embodiment 1:
In the present embodiment, as shown in Figure 1, a kind of vertical surface carving machine, including engine base 1, the engine base 1 are equipped with installation The lower section of the workbench 7 of tooling 6, workbench 7 is equipped with saddle 8;
Column 3 is provided on engine base 1, the babinet slide 4 being provided on column 3 above workbench 7, babinet slide 4 The upper promising process tool of setting provides the electro spindle 5 of kinetic energy;
Further include servo motor, Serve Motor Control workbench 7 moves in the X direction, directly controls saddle 8 and drives work Platform 7 moves in the Y direction, also controls babinet slide 4 and electro spindle 5 moves in z-direction.
Embodiment 2:
The present embodiment further limits process tool on the basis of the above embodiments, and the process tool is ball knife.This The other parts of embodiment are identical with above-described embodiment, and which is not described herein again.
Embodiment 3:
The present embodiment further adds the manner of execution of ball screw and ball screw on the basis of the above embodiments, adds Work cutter is connect with ball screw, and ball screw is driven by servo motor, and servo motor drives tooling 6 with workbench 7 in X-axis It moves left and right, servo motor drives 8 saddle Y-axis to be moved forward and backward, and servo motor drives 4 babinet slides to be moved down on 5 electro spindle Z axis It is dynamic, it can realize that electro spindle X, Y, Z are processed using three-axis numerical control system.The other parts of the present embodiment and above-mentioned implementation Example is identical, and which is not described herein again.
Embodiment 4:
The present embodiment further adds chip removal screw rod 2 on the basis of the above embodiments, and the lower section of saddle 8 is provided with row Consider screw rod 2 to be worth doing, the machined copper scale of finishing impression, aluminium skimmings can recycle i.e. clean and tidy and environmentally friendly automatically.The other parts of the present embodiment Identical with above-described embodiment, which is not described herein again.
Embodiment 5:
The present embodiment further limits the work that the workbench 7 is equipped with mounting tool 6 on the basis of the above embodiments Clamps.The quantity of affiliated frock clamp is eight, can disposably process 8 products, high in machining efficiency.
The other parts of the present embodiment are identical with above-described embodiment, and which is not described herein again.
Embodiment 6:
It includes cylinder 10 and and cylinder that the present embodiment further limits the frock clamp on the basis of the above embodiments The upper plates 11 of 10 connections, are connected with fixture pattern 12 on upper plate 11;Workpiece compression bar 14 is also associated on cylinder 10 and for controlling The hand valve 15 that the fixture of cylinder 10 unclamps and steps up, cylinder 10 are connect with upper plate 11, and fixture pattern 12 is connect with upper plate 11, work Part compression bar 14 is connect with cylinder 10, and hand valve 15 is to control the fixture release of cylinder 10 and step up, when workpiece is placed on fixture pattern 12 workpiece pressing of workpiece compression bar on 12.The other parts of the present embodiment are identical with above-described embodiment, and which is not described herein again.
Embodiment 7:
The present embodiment further limits the cylinder on the basis of the above embodiments(10)Quantity at least there are two.This The other parts of embodiment are identical with above-described embodiment, and which is not described herein again.
